BiographyHistory

Elliot Stock commenced business as a bookseller on Paternoster Row in London in 1859. The firm published non-sectarian religious material, and a well-known series of facsimile reprints of classics and religious works. A serious literary publisher, it published the London Quarterly Review from 1865.

Stock was a bibliophile and a distinguished bibliographer, who founded a number of bibliographical serials, and whose work is still in use. In 1908 he sold his business to Robert Scott, who retained the imprint until 1939.
